WirelessDevNet.com Press Release

StreamerNet(R) and Stargate Mobile Deliver Mobile Audio/Video Streaming Technologies


LEESBURG, Va. and GRAND BLANC, Mich., March 22 -- StreamerNet Corporation and Stargate Mobile LLC today announced an agreement under which mobile audio/video streaming technologies will be offered as a standard option for Ford Motor Company F-150 and F-250 trucks shipped with the FORDLINK(TM) Mobile Office package.

Ford Motor Company announced the Mobile Office package in November at the Specialty Equipment Market Association (SEMA) show in Las Vegas. The following link takes you to the official Ford Motor Company announcement: Ford Truck 'Mobile Office' Allows Business on the Go http://media.ford.com/newsroom/release_display.cfm?release=21909

The essence of the Stargate Mobile Office initiative is to bring to market a system that features a rugged but lightweight, in-truck computer (Stargate) running Windows XP Professional with Microsoft Office capabilities, plus navigation with GPS, broadband/wireless Internet access, printing, along with order submission, payment processing capabilities, and a variety of other mobile computing applications such as StreamerNet audio/video solutions. The solution provides a very flexible computing platform from which a contractor can bid jobs, order and purchase parts and materials, and process payments while 'on location' from their truck.

"The Stargate Mobile Office is designed for businesses, large or small, that primarily operate out in the field," stated Johnny Cooper, president of Stargate Mobile. "This community includes a broad array of industry categories including construction (commercial and residential), utilities, sub-contractors, engineers, project management, emergency response, government and many others."

Stargate Mobile has been working with Ford since the inception of the Ford Mobile Office concept and has led the development of the Ford Mobile Office components. One of the biggest challenges the teams faced during development was understanding exactly what activities the contractor-customers were performing in the fields and then determining which business functions would be the most critical in a truck-based mobile office.

The Stargate Mobile computer is a rugged lightweight touch-screen slate model mounted on the transmission tunnel within easy reach of the driver. Once the computer is securely mounted in its vehicle cradle, it is powered by the truck's battery and is directly connected to optional equipment including GPS antenna, printer, credit card scanner, or digital camera.

The driver can remove the touch-screen computer and take it with him or her just as an ordinary laptop, but it isn't hampered by the unnecessary weight of a keyboard, unless that optional attachment is necessary. The lightweight, versatile slate design is also constructed to withstand the typical use on a jobsite, including the occasional drop onto a dirt parking lot. It features a screen that is visible in sunlight, so that several workers can huddle around for an impromptu meeting viewing blueprints or online order tracking.

The slate model computer offers full Windows XP Professional functionality with all the power of a full-size desktop computer whenever and wherever you need it, allowing the driver in-vehicle, finger-tip access to the familiar programs of the Windows XP-based PC.
